Skip to content

Pork-Potatoes/Pork-Potatoes-Front

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 

Repository files navigation

🎓 신촌대 맛집전공 🎓

Hits

프론트엔드 팀원 소개

이해린 이윤지 정드림
[마이페이지], [리스트페이지], 헤더 컴포넌트, 리뷰 컴포넌트, 식당 컴포넌트 구현 [메인페이지], 지도, 플로팅버튼 구현 [메인페이지] [로그인팝업], [검색결과 페이지] 구현

백엔드 팀원 소개

박현아 김시연 김민주 이서정
백, 가게와 폴더(가게 리스트) 관련 기능. [리뷰 작성 페이지]맛집 이름 검색, [검색 페이지]가게 검색 결과 반환, [가게 상세 페이지]가게 정보 반환, [가게 상세 페이지]가게 정보 반환 기능 개발 등. 팀원들과 함께 DB 모델 설계, API 명세서 작성, 유저, 소셜로그인 관련 API 개발, 리스트 즐겨찾기 관련 API 개발 메뉴 반환, 임시 메뉴 저장, 리뷰 검색 기능, 신고 기능 개발 리뷰 테이블 관련 리뷰의 조회, 등록, 삭제 기능 개발, 리뷰 리스트 조회 API 담당

폴더 구조

💻 food-major
 ┣ 🗂 node_modules
 ┣ 🗂 public
 ┃ ┗ 📑 index.html
 ┣ 🗂 src
 ┃ ┣ 🗂 assets
 ┃ ┣ 🗂 components
 ┃ ┃ ┣ 📑 Header.js
 ┃ ┃ ┣ 📑 ImgSlide.js
 ┃ ┃ ┣ 📑 List.js
 ┃ ┃ ┣ 📑 MyButton.js
 ┃ ┃ ┣ 📑 Restaurant.js
 ┃ ┃ ┣ 📑 Review.js
 ┃ ┃ ┣ 📑 Sidebar.js
 ┃ ┃ ┣ 📑 SignIn.js
 ┃ ┃ ┗ 📑 SignIn.css
 ┃ ┣ 🗂 pages
 ┃ ┃ ┣ 📑 DetailPage.js
 ┃ ┃ ┣ 📑 LikedList.js
 ┃ ┃ ┣ 📑 ListPage.js
 ┃ ┃ ┣ 📑 MainPage.js
 ┃ ┃ ┣ 📑 MyListPage.js
 ┃ ┃ ┣ 📑 MyPage.js
 ┃ ┃ ┣ 📑 MyReviewPage.js
 ┃ ┃ ┣ 📑 SearchPage.js
 ┃ ┃ ┗ 📑 SettingPage.js
 ┃ ┣ 📑 App.js
 ┃ ┣ 📑 App.css
 ┃ ┣ 📑 index.js
 ┃ ┣ 📑 App.js
 ┃ ┗ 📑 npmlist
 ┗ 📑 package.json

개발 환경

React Spring

라이브러리

라이브러리(Library) 목적(Purpose)
react-material-ui-carousel 이미지 슬라이더
react-router-dom 라우터
react-kakao-login 카카오 로그인
react-floating-action-button 플로팅 버튼
react-icons 아이콘